Catalog description
This course is an intensive focus on an applied area of psychology. Students will explore the various career paths commonly pursued by psychology majors. Particular emphasis will be placed on how to maximize one’s likelihood of being hired for a job or being successfully admitted into a graduate program. Students earn a letter grade for course. It is open to both majors and non-majors. Majors can use up to three workshops to satisfy elective requirements within the Psychology or HRM major.
